The Certificate Course in Housekeeping at the Institute of Science and Management (ISMR), Ranchi, is a 1-year full-time short-term programme offered under the hospitality and hotel management division of the institute. The programme is designed to provide students with practical skills in housekeeping operations, room management, laundry services, public area cleaning, linen management, and related hospitality support functions. The total fee for the 1-year programme is INR 80,000. This is a job-oriented certificate course that equips students with industry-ready skills for careers in hotels, resorts, hospitals, corporate offices, and facility management companies. ISMR has been a pioneer in hotel management and hospitality education in Eastern India since 1985, and this certificate course is part of its short-term job-oriented programme portfolio that also includes courses in Bakery and Confectionery, Food and Beverage Service, Travel and Tour Operations, and Front Office.

Admissions for the 2026-27 batch are currently open. The institute has officially announced admissions for the academic year 2026-27 and applications can be submitted through the official website ismr.ac.in. Based on the previous year's pattern, the batch typically commences in July-August 2026.

ISMR Certificate Housekeeping Fees

Fee Structure

Fee ComponentAmount (INR)
Tuition Fee (Total for 1 Year)₹40,000
Admission Fee (One-time, Non-refundable)₹40,000
Total Academic Fee₹80,000
Hostel Fee - Shared Room (INR 1,000/month x 12 months)₹12,000
Hostel Fee - Single Room (INR 1,500/month x 12 months)₹18,000
Canteen Charges (INR 3,000/month - optional)As applicable
Total Fees (Without Hostel)₹80,000
Total Fees (With Hostel - Shared Room)₹92,000
Total Fees (With Hostel - Single Room)₹98,000
  • The admission fee is non-refundable and is payable at the time of admission.
  • Hostel is optional and not mandatory.
  • Students can choose between a shared room (INR 1,000/month) or a single room (INR 1,500/month).
  • Canteen charges of INR 3,000/month are separate and optional.
  • A registration/application fee of INR 600 is charged at the time of form submission.
  • Students may contact the admissions office at 7858001234 for any payment schedule arrangements.

Eligibility Criteria

  • Candidates must have passed 10th or 12th standard from a recognised board.
  • There is no minimum percentage requirement specified; candidates from any stream are eligible.
  • Candidates appearing in the 10th/12th examination are also eligible to apply provisionally.

Admission Process

  • Visit the official website ismr.ac.in and fill the certificate course application form online or download and submit it offline.
  • Submit the completed application form along with required documents and an application fee of INR 600.
  • Admission is granted on a merit-cum-first-come-first-served basis.
  • Required documents include: 10th mark sheet and certificate, passport-size photographs, and identity proof.

Ques. What is covered in the Certificate Course in Housekeeping at ISMR, and what practical skills will I develop?

Ans. The Certificate Course in Housekeeping at ISMR covers all key aspects of hotel housekeeping operations including guest room cleaning and maintenance, bed making, linen and laundry management, public area cleaning, housekeeping chemicals and equipment usage, inventory management, and basic supervisory skills. The course is heavily practical-oriented, with students training in simulated hotel room environments. Students also learn about hygiene standards, safety protocols, and guest interaction skills that are essential for a career in hotel housekeeping.

Ques. What career opportunities are available after completing the Certificate in Housekeeping from ISMR?

Ans. Graduates of this certificate course can pursue careers as room attendants, housekeeping supervisors, laundry assistants, public area cleaners, and linen room attendants in hotels, resorts, hospitals, corporate offices, and facility management companies. With experience, they can progress to roles like housekeeping team leader, floor supervisor, or executive housekeeper. The hospitality and facility management industry in India is growing rapidly, and trained housekeeping professionals are in demand across 3-star, 4-star, and 5-star hotels. ISMR's industry connections also help in facilitating placements for certificate course graduates.

Ques. How does the Certificate in Housekeeping differ from the broader DHMCT programme at ISMR?

Ans. The Certificate in Housekeeping is a 1-year specialised programme focused exclusively on housekeeping operations, while the DHMCT (Diploma in Hotel Management and Catering Technology) is a 3-year comprehensive programme covering all areas of hotel management including food production, food and beverage service, front office, accommodation operations, and bakery. The certificate course is suitable for students who want to quickly enter the housekeeping department of the hospitality industry, while the DHMCT is better for those who want a broader understanding of hotel operations and aspire to managerial roles. The DHMCT also carries more weight in terms of career advancement and higher studies.
